Union Catalogue of Manuscripts from the Islamicate World

MS McClean 200* (Manuscript Collections, The Fitzwilliam Museum)

The Fitzwilliam Museum

Contents

A Scrapbook of Calligraphy

Language(s): Arabic and Persian

References

Physical Description

Form: folios
Support: paper
Extent: 20 ff.

Hand(s)

Decoration

Some calligraphic specimens are finely decorated.

Provenance and Acquisition

Bequeathed by Mr Frank McClean in 1904.

Record Sources

Manuscript description based on James Montague Rhodes "A Descriptive Catalogue of the McClean Collection of Manuscripts in the Fitzwilliam Museum", Cambridge University Press, 1912; with corrections and additions supplied by Marcus Fraser and Giorgia M. Maffioli Brigatti.
